Chemistry course for radiochemistry engineers on the platform Moodle: a support to self-education for undergraduate students
The education challenges at present times include the incorporation of information and communication technologies (ICT) in the learning-teaching process. In Higher Education the agreement between the volume of information to be processed by the student, the available student’s time and the assimilation of the courses contents is very important. The new study plans in Cuban Universities include the reduction of the number of face to face hours and the increase of the available time for the student’s independent study. Then, it is necessary to develop abilities that upgrade learning capacity during a lifetime through the self-education. The first version of a course on chemistry for radiochemistry students using the platform Moodle and Open Educational Resources (OER) as a support to the undergraduate course is presented. The detailed topic plan of the course of chemistry for radiochemists, which was distributed week by week, and different activities combining communication, interactive and collaborative modules were implemented on the platform Moodle. The whole system was tested during the first semester of the 2010-2011 academic year. The course evaluation results were carried out through a survey among the students and discussion forums. The results showed a good acceptance by the students, a better efficiency in the teaching-learning process given by better planning of the individual study, a better preparation to perform the laboratory practices, the new possibilities of communication between students and teachers, the access to OER and greater self-conscious of the students on their own process of learning

Dynamical Modelling and Simulation of Waste water Filtration Process by Submerged Membrane Bioreactors
A mathematical model was developed for the filtration process and the influence of aeration on Submerged Membrane Bioreactors. The dynamics of sludge attachment to and detachment from the membrane, in relation to the filtration and a strong intermittent aeration, were included in the model. The influence on the membrane fouling of intermittent aeration injected on the membrane surface, and its synchronization with intermittent filtration, were studied numerically and experimentally. For the evaluation of filtration cake development, the assumption of the presence of two cake layers (one dynamic and the other stable) was considered. The model development and simulation focused on the description of existing relationships among important system variables like mixed liquor suspended solids concentration, aeration, temperature of the sludge suspension, transmembrane pressure, and the fouling increase during the filtration process. The model obtained offers the possibility of improving the design configuration and operation strategies of Submerged Membrane Bioreactors in wastewater treatment, and it allows the of aeration-filtration cycles to be optimized
The premises and evaluation of new regulations aiming at limiting risk in the banking sector
This paper will aim at proving that the introduction of the reforms known
as Basel III considerably eliminates the deficits of the Basel regulations from
2004, but will result in lower availability of loans for bank clients and will
slow down the economic development.
The article consists of three sections. The first part presents the role and
challenges facing banks in times of crisis. In the second part special attention
has been paid to the main assumptions of the changes proposed by the Basel
Committee on Banking Supervision. The third chapter focuses on analyzing the
predicted influence of Basel III on economy and banks operating in Poland and
all over the world
Uregulowania nadzoru bankowego w nowej umowie kapitałowej (Basel II) i ocena ich konsekwencji dla polskiego sektora bankowego
The rapidly developing globalisation of world economies has caused that
it has become necessary to establish international authorities to control public entities (including, but not limited to, banks). These are banks that operate in the international market in an especially active manner. To reduce any and all irregularities in the banking sector, the Basel Committee on Banking Supervision was established. As a result of further actions, the New Basel Capital Accord (Basel II), in details defining the methodology of capital adequacy measurement and target standards for the banking supervision, was published.
The purpose of this document is to present major regulations of the New Capital Accord and assess their impact on the Polish banking sector. On the basis of a selected group of banks in Poland, we discuss the impact of new guidelines, for example, on a solvency ratio

Flow Induced by Dual-Turbine of Different Diameters in a Gas-Liquid Agitation System: the Agitation and Turbulence Indices
Flow induced by a dual turbine stirred tank was characterized measuring local velocities with a LDV and drawing the main velocity fields and the maps of turbulence intensities. The hydrodynamic regime studied in all the experiments was the so-called merging flow regime. Two impeller configurations were studied. In the first one, two disk style turbine of the same dimensions (configuration A) were used, while in the second one, the dimensions of the upper turbine were 20 % proportionally smaller than those of the lower turbine (configuration B). The agitation and turbulence indices were used to evaluate, as a first order approximation, the power consumption distribution between convective and turbulent flows. The comparison of the two-phase agitation systems studied showed that configuration B seems to be more efficient than configuration A, since both induce a similar global convective flow, but the first one assures a significant reduction of power consumption.
